Output 61ec32017ccc28d3d3c3316cd401a68d8825d483509e92320fee214ff77681f0:1
- value
- 2596678
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f3088f82a86d6deb49c183efffc68b997e63138 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CbWxdtHPANGRDcseYhrGnseRLVWC5g479
- transaction
- 61ec32017ccc28d3d3c3316cd401a68d8825d483509e92320fee214ff77681f0
- confirmations
- 445067
- spent
- true